O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S

The process of production of bags from Concept Fresh rolls - VB2203, VB2806

  1. Connect the unit to the mains.
  2. Unwind a section of the foil you will need for storing of your food and cut it off with scissors, adding approx. 10 cm in length to allow for sealing and bag shrinkage (Fig. 1). If you wish to reuse the bags, add about 1.5 cm for each use so that the bag can be resealed after cutting off the seal. Both ends are to be cut perpendicular to the longitudinal edge of the roll.
  3. Open the lid of the unit and insert one of the cut edges into the unit, so that the edge of the foil touches the gasket of the seal vacuum chamber (6). The bag must not overlap into the vacuum chamber (5) (Fig. 2).
  4. Close the lid and press it down firmly on both sides (Fig. 3). The unit turns on when snapped shut. Once the bag is sealed, the unit automatically turns off. Open the lid by pressing the grey buttons on the sides of the appliance (Fig. 4).

Vacuum sealing of prepared bags from Concept Fresh rolls - VB2203, VB2806

  1. Fill the bag so that the content is approx. 7.5 cm from the open end of the bag. Make sure that neither the outside nor the inside of this part of the bag is contaminated with the stored food.
  2. Insert the open end of the bag into the vacuum chamber (6), between the gaskets (5). The end of the bag must be free of ripples and wrinkles (Fig. 5).
  3. Close the lid and by pressing the lid switch on the unit (Fig. 6). After the air is completely removed out of the bag, the vacuuming process is automatically terminated and the bag is sealed.
  4. Before reuse, wait for about 1 minute until the unit cools down.

Important:

Use only original bags made from Concept Fresh rolls VB2203 and VB2806.

Remove excess moisture before the vacuuming process!

Never vacuum seal bags filled with a liquid!

Vacuum packaging of food in Concept Fresh canisters VD8100, VD8200 and wine stopper VD8300

  1. Fill the canister up to 2.5 cm below the edge.
  2. Wipe off any food residues or moisture on the edge of the canister.
  3. Insert one end of the tube (supplied as part of each set of canisters/wine stoppers) into the vacuum opening (3) in the vacuum chamber and the other end into the opening in the lid of the canister/stopper (Fig.7).
  4. Move the button on the lid of VD8100 canisters to the „SEAL" position. Turn the unit on by pressing the safety switch (1) and hold it for about 1 minute until the process is completed (Fig. 8). After the vacuuming process is completed, the unit automatically turns off. Remove the tube from the lid and store the canister as required.
  5. The vacuuming process should take at least 1 minute depending on the size of the canister and its content. The characteristic sound will tell you when the process is finished (for VD8200 canisters check the red button on the lid, which is sucked inside during the vacuuming process).

Important:

The sealing element is hot throughout the entire vacuuming process. Do not touch it!

  1. To open the canister:

VD8100 canister set - turn the button on the cover to the „OPEN” position VD8200 canister set - press the blue button and hold until the lid cannot be reopened VD8300 wine stopper set - pull the stopper out the neck of the bottle

Tip:

To prevent loss of the tube, store the tube in the opening inside the lid of the unit (Fig. 9).

The unit is equipped with an opening in the bottom for the storage of the power cord. Do not wrap the cord around the appliance!

BEST PERFORMANCE TIPS

  1. Do not overfill the bags or the canisters. Always leave enough space, see the instructions above.
  2. Do not use the unit to seal bags if the area to be sealed is contaminated or wet. Always wipe and dry ends of the bag before sealing.
  3. Do not leave too much air in the bag. Always remove as much excess air as possible before sealing the bag.
  4. Do not vacuum items with sharp edges that could tear the bag. Use suitable canisters for items with sharp edges.
  5. Allow about 1 minute for the unit to cool down before reuse.
  6. If the unit is unable to complete the vacuum packaging process, it switches off automatically after 45 seconds. Check the seal on the bag and the position of the bag in the vacuum chamber.
  7. Prevent liquids from entering the vacuum chamber or the opening as it would cause subsequent damage to the unit. If you want to package moist food, froze the food first and wipe the bag with a paper towel.
  8. Liquids can only be vacuum packed in canisters that are available for purchase as additional accessories. Wait until the liquids are cold!
  9. Any vacuum packed perishable food is to be stored in the refrigerator or freezer. Vacuum packaging only makes the food stay fresh longer, but it does not protect the food from spoiling.
  10. The vacuum packing system can be used not only to store food but also to protect valuables (e.g. documents, electronics, medication, etc.)
    11 Before each use, make sure that the vacuum chamber and opening are clean and free from any impurities.
  11. Any damage caused to the unit due to the entry of food residues sucked in from the vacuum chamber is not covered by the warranty!

CLEANING AND MAINTENANCE

  1. Always unplug the unit before cleaning.
  2. Do not immerse the unit or any of its parts in water and do not wash in the dishwasher.
  3. Avoid using abrasive products, solvents or hot water to clean the unit or any of its parts.
  4. Wipe the surface of the unit with a damp cloth and a mild detergent.
    Wipe out the inside of the unit with a paper towel to remove any food and liquid residues.
  5. Dry thoroughly before reuse.

Cleaning of bags and canisters for reuse

Before reuse, wash the bags in warm soapy water and rinse thoroughly.

Important:

Do not clean in the dishwasher; high temperature would damage the bags and canisters.

Do not immerse the lids in water, clean them with a damp cloth and a mild detergent.

canisters are not intended for heating food in the microwave or storing food in the freezer.

Warning:

Do not reuse bags, which were previously used to store raw meat, or heated in boiling water or the microwave.

TROUBLESHOOTING

1. The device does not work

  • Check if the supply cord is properly connected and not damaged.
  • Check whether the bag is in the correct position and not outside the vacuum chamber.
  • Make sure the lid is closed properly.

2. Air is not removed from the bag completely

  • Make sure the open end of the bag is properly inserted in the vacuum chamber. If the edge of the bag overlaps the gasket of the vacuum groove, the air will not be sucked out, although the seal is tight.
  • Check for leaks by immersing the bag in a canister filled with water. Any escaping bubbles indicate a leak. In this case, use another bag or cut off the leaking seal and re-seal the bag.
  • Do not make additional seals on the sealed sides of the bag. The bags are provided with special seals on the sides that are tight along the entire length of the outer edge. Attempts to make a new side seal could cause leakage and entry of air.

3. Air has re-entered the bag after being sealed

  • Check the sealing of the bag (see previous paragraph).
  • If a leak is discovered, cut off the seal and reseal the bag.
  • Moisture contained in food or the food itself (juices, grease, crumbs, etc.) prevents proper sealing of the bag. Reopen the bag, dry and clean the area around the seal and re-seal.
  • Items with sharp edges or points may puncture the bag. Wrap food and items with sharp edges or points with soft material (e.g. a paper towel) and seal the bag.

4. The bag melts

The sealing element may be overheated after repeated use. After each use, allow the unit to cool down for about 1 minute.

INSTRUCTIONS AND INFORMATION FOR CORRECT USE OF THE unit

Chemical reactions in food exposed to air, temperature, moisture, and enzyme action, growth of microorganisms or contamination from insects will cause food spoilage. They also cause freezer burn to improperly packed food due to water evaporation. Vacuum packaging can slow down this process. Vacuum packaging is a scientifically tested food storing method of storing, which keeps food fresh up to five times longer than other used methods.

  1. Vacuum packaging does not replace thermal processes during food preservation. Perishable food should always be stored in the refrigerator or freezer.
  2. During the suction of the air a small amounts of liquids, crumbs or food particles may be released into the vacuum chamber and cause damage. Therefore, always check that it is free of any food residues.
  3. Always make sure that the bags are not overfilled or contaminated up to about 7 cm from the seal (both on the outside and the inside).
  4. Freeze any moist and juicy food such as raw meat before inserting into the bag. You can also place a folded paper towel inside the upper part of the bag (away from the sealed part) before vacuum packaging to catch excess moisture.
  5. Deep freeze soups, sauces and other liquids first, for example, in a suitable container.
  6. Do not put powdered and fine grained food in the bag loosely as it could be sucked out. This type of food can be placed in the bag or the canister in a paper towel or another suitable package.
  7. Do not make your own seals on the side of the bags. The foil is provided with a special side seal which is tight along its entire length.
  8. In order to prevent creasing or rippling, gently stretch the foil along the length of the vacuum chamber before closing the lid of the unit.
  9. Make sure that the edge of the bag does not slip out of the vacuum chamber when closing the lid.
  10. If you store food with sharp edges, protect the bag from tearing by wrapping the food item in a paper napkin or a towel. You can also use a suitable canister.
  11. Never reuse bags that have been used to store raw meat or that have been used for cooking or placed in the microwave.
  12. Never defrost or re-heat food in canisters in the microwave!

FOOD SAFETY

The vacuum packaging process extends the shelf-life of food by removing most of the air from a sealed storage container or a bag, thus reducing food oxidation which affects the nutritional value, taste and overall quality of food. The removal of air also slows down the growth of microorganisms that may, under certain conditions, reduce the quality of food. These microorganisms include mainly:

Mould - mould cannot grow in an environment with low oxygen content and thus the vacuum packaging method is very efficient in reducing its growth.

Yeast - yeast cells need water, sugar and an appropriate temperature to proliferate. They can survive in air as well as without air. Refrigeration is required to slow down the growth of yeast cells. Freezing inhibits their growth completely.

Bacteria - the growth of bacteria can be significantly reduced at temperatures of 4^ or less. Freezing to -17^ does not kill microorganisms, but inhibits their growth and proliferation. In the case of long term storage of perishable food always freeze the food while using the vacuum packaging technology. Once defrosted, keep the food refrigerated at low temperatures.

CAUTION:

Vacuum packaging is not intended as a substitute to canning. Vacuum packaging is able to slow down the processes causing deterioration of food. Perishable food that needs to be frozen or stored in the refrigerator must be kept at the same temperature after vacuum packaging.

TIPS FOR VACUUM PACKAGING AND RE-HEATING OF FOOD

Defrosting and re-heating of vacuum packed food

Always defrost food in the refrigerator or in the microwave. Do not defrost perishable food at room temperature.

Never defrost food in canisters in the microwave.

When re-heating food packed in bags always cut off one corner of the bag before placing the bag in the microwave.

Do not re-heat bones and fatty food in bags in the microwave, as this will prevent the possibility of overheating. It is recommended to heat these types of food by placing the food in water and gently heating through at a temperature of about 75 °C.

Vacuum packaging of meat and fish:

For best results, put the meat or fish in the freezer for 1 or 2 hours before vacuum packaging. Afterwards, use a bag from a foil roll designed for vacuum packaging of food. This will help the food keep its juice and shape.

If you cannot pre-freeze the food, place a folded towel between the meat and the top part of the bag. Keep this paper towel in the bag to absorb excess moisture and juices escaping during the process of vacuum packaging. Make sure the towel does not overlap to the sealing area.

Note: Beef may become dark after vacuum packaging. This occurs due to the removal of oxygen and it does not indicate deterioration of the food.

Vacuum packaging of hard cheeses:

To keep cheese fresh as long as possible, vacuum pack after each opening and use. Prepare a long bag from the foil roll so that you always have 2.5 cm of the bag for each reopening and repacking of the bag. In addition, leave a standard space of 7.5 cm between the contents of the bag and the seal. You can also pack the cheese in a canister.

IMPORTANT: Never use vacuum packaging for soft cheeses.

Vacuum packaging of vegetables:

We recommend cleaning and blanching (i.e. by brief immersion in hot water) the vegetables before vacuum packaging. This process inhibits enzyme activity that could cause the loss of taste, colour and texture.

Note: Blanch the vegetables by cooking briefly in boiling water or placing them in the microwave: 1 to 2 minutes for leafy vegetables, 3 to 4 minutes for peas in pods, sliced zucchini or broccoli, 5 minutes for carrots and 7 to 11 minutes for corncobs. Vegetables should stay crispy. After blanching, immerse immediately in cold water to stop the cooking process. Finally, dry thoroughly and pack.

To freeze the vegetables, it is recommended to pre-freeze them first for 1 to 2 hours until stiff. Before freezing, divide the vegetables into individual portions and spread them on a baking pan so that the pieces do not touch each other. This will prevent the vegetables from sticking together. Immediately after freezing, wrap the vegetables and put them in the freezer.

Note: All kinds of vegetables (including broccoli, Brussels sprouts, cabbage, cauliflower, kale, turnips, etc.) release gases during storage (it is a natural process). Therefore, blanched vegetables must always be stored in the freezer.

IMPORTANT: Never use vacuum packaging to store mushrooms.

More tips for vacuum packaging of leafy vegetables:

For best results, store leafy vegetables in Concept Fresh VD8100 and VD8200 canisters. First, wash the vegetables properly and dry them with a paper towel or in a centrifuge. Place the dried leaves in a canister and remove the air. Store the canister in the refrigerator.

Vacuum packaging of fruit:

Follow the same steps as in the case of vegetables, only without blanching.

You can freeze individual portions for future use or store a small quantity in the refrigerator for quick consumption. We recommend storing fruit in Concept Fresh canisters.

Vacuum packaging of bread:

It is recommended to vacuum pack bread in Concept Fresh canisters, as they are able to retain its original shape. When using bags, pre-freeze the bread for 1 to 2 hours or until completely frozen.

Vacuum packaging of coffee and powdered food:

To prevent the penetration of small particles of food into the vacuum pump, insert a coffee filter or a paper towel into the top part of the bag or canister to prevent the fine material from being sucked up. You can also place food in the bag or canister in its original packaging.

Vacuum packaging of liquids:

For vacuum packaging of liquids in original bottles (wine, oil, etc.) it is recommended to use the original Set of wine stoppers - VD8300. If these stoppers cannot be used, pre-freeze the liquid food in a canister of a suitable shape and size before packing.

Before use, cut off one corner of the bag and defrost in the microwave or in water at 75 °C.

Vacuum packaging of non-food items:

The Concept Fresh vacuum packaging system can also be used to protect non-food materials and items from oxidation, corrosion and moisture. When vacuum packaging these items, follow the steps used for food packaging and use the original Concept Fresh bags or canisters.

When vacuum packaging items with sharp points, wrap the points with a soft material to prevent puncturing of the bag.

Vacuum packaging is an ideal solution for trips to the nature, camping and hiking to pack equipment such as clothing, matches, electronics, maps and food that needs to be kept dry. You can also pack ice, which turns into drinking water after melting.

FOOD STORAGE MANUAL

storage time vacuum pack storage time

Refrigerated food 5-2 °C

Red meat 3-4 days 8-9 days

White meat 2-3 days 6-9 days

Whole fish 1-3 days 4-5 days

Venison 1-3 days 5-7 days

Smoked meat 7-15 days 25-40 days

Sliced smoked meat 4-6 days 20-25 days

Soft cheese 5-7 days 14-20 days

Hard cheese 15-20 days 25-60 days

Vegetable products 1-3 days 7-10 days

Fruit 5-7 days 14-20 days

Cooked, processed food

Vegetable purees, soups 2-3 days 6-10 days

Pasta, rice 2-3 days 6-8 days

Cooked, roasted meat 3-5 days 10-15 days

Soft bread 2-3 days 6-8 days

Deep-frying oil 10-15 days 25-40 days

Frozen Food -18-2 °C

Meat 4-6 months 15-20 months

Fish 3-4 months 10-12 months

Vegetables 8-10 months 18-24 months

Food at room temperature 25-2 °C

Bread 1-2 days 6-8 days

Packed biscuits 4-6 months 12 months

Pasta 5-6 months 12 months

Rice 5-6 months 12 months

Flour 4-5 months 12 months

Dried fruit 3-4 months 12 months

Ground coffee 2-3 months 12 months

12 months

Powdered milk 1-2 months 12 months

Powdered food 1-2 months 12 months
